To try and answer Stinky244's question and this might contain a few early spoilers about it - five new areas, unsure how that's calculated, you land in the hover tank like vehicle but can't drive it, at least not here, and it's a rogue (Or hidden or something.) Cerberus base researching something (I don't know what yet.) but things go wrong.
(It seems to contain a bit more content but it's probably not as long as the main quest content in the original game, meaning part of it of course like say the Krogan planet or Geth base and such.)
Based on the ending video (BIK movie.) it seems to be action oriented though it begins a bit quiter and sets up the story and explains things though that changes relatively quickly I would guess.
(Only just started exploring the base so I'm not very far into it, expecting 2 hours or so all in all at most of content so a bit longer than Kasumi or Firewalker though those weren't that long either actually.)
